Tamarra Graham is a Detroit native, licensed clinical psychologist, and U.S. Navy veteran. No stranger to drama, she is a Scenie Award winner for Breakout Actress of the Year in Bee-luther-hatchee and Pure Confidence. She has also made the rounds showcasing her comedy chops at the Second City, Upright Citizens Brigade, iO, The Pack Theater, and Comedy Central Stage. When not on stage, you can find her singing karaoke, watching The Real Housewives, hiking, or twisting her hair into bantu knots.
